- Conduct and manage all clinical trial activities in accordance with established research protocols and standards in compliance with all applicable laws, regulations, policies, and procedural requirements.
- Complete all relevant Profound Research required training, including but not limited to ICH-GCP certification and IATA certification in a timely manner.
- Mentor and train staff in the conduct of clinical trials, protocol requirements, communication and trial management skills.
- Lead, implement and coordinate duties for assigned clinical trials including but not limited to study start up, vendor management, subject recruitment, source document review and completion, protocol training, collection of regulatory documents, participant visits, timely data collection and documentation, management and reporting of adverse events, serious adverse events, and deviations, and monitoring visits and follow up.
- Ensure good documentation practices are applied by all team members when collecting, maintaining and correcting study data and required records of clinical trial activity including but not limited to source documentation, case report forms, queries, drug dispensation records, and regulatory forms.
- Communicate effectively and professionally with coworkers, leadership, study subjects, sponsors, CROs, and vendors.
- Collect and account for supplies from sponsors such as lab kits, ancillary supplies, and investigational products.
- Other duties as assigned.
- Bachelor’s degree and 2 years relevant experience in the life science industry OR
- Associate’s degree with 4 years relevant experience in the life science industry OR
- High School Graduate and/or technical degree with minimum of 6 years relevant experience in the life science industry AND 1 year
- Clinical Research Coordinator experience
- Successful completion of GCP certification and Certified Clinical Research Coordinator (CCRC) certification within 6 months of being in the role
- Experience performing clinical assessments, including but not limited to obtaining vital signs, EKGs, blood draws, processing/shipping lab specimens
- Proficient ability to work independently, plan and prioritize with minimal guidance
- Excellent attention to detail, organization, and communication with varied stakeholders
- Ability to work as a team player with the ability to adapt to changing schedules and assignments

Are there remote clinical research associate jobs in Detroit?
Yes, but with limits: clinical research associate work is heavily site-based by nature, so fully remote roles are less common than in purely desk-based fields. About 53% of clinical research associate openings tied to Detroit are remote or hybrid as of September 2026, with remote work most available for data review, regulatory document management, and sponsor-side monitoring roles rather than on-site patient-facing coordination.
How can I get a clinical research associate job in Detroit with little or no experience?
The most realistic entry path in Detroit is through a clinical research coordinator or research assistant role at one of the city's academic medical centers or large hospital networks, which regularly hire candidates with a life sciences degree and lab or patient-facing experience. Detroit's robust teaching hospital ecosystem means entry-level research staff openings appear regularly, and moving into a clinical research associate role after one to two years of site coordination experience is a well-established local progression.
